Kootek Charcuterie Board with Locking Lid is a decent board.
The base is a nice solid wood board with spaces for different meats, cheeses, etc. The board is not too heavy, so it is fairly lightweight and easy to carry. The base is study and will most likely last for some time if hand washed and dried immediately.
The wood must be treated to protect it as it comes untreated. Choose your favorite food safe method.
The lid is a hard lightweight plastic that feels as though it is ready to crack at any second. It will not survive a good pop from anything. Thus, this is not a lid I would use to transport the board from one place to another. Set it up when you arrive, and the lid is great to keep the board items covered. I would not wash it in the dish washer as I doubt it would not warp – we handwashed it only.
The handles are also a cheaper plastic. I did not carry the board by the handles out of fear of the handles breaking off. We did do a test lift, and the handles survived, but I still worry that carrying by the handle is not a good idea.
The latches are not as easy as I would like to latch and since they are also made from cheap plastic, they will most likely not last long if they are used much.
The board looks adorable and is great to have on a table at a party. It also makes a great way to store a board of snacks to have in the frig for family to grab a few tidbits and go. It came with easy-to-follow instructions.
Overall, I like the board itself but have doubts and am not a fan of the cheaply made lid. It is not a good value at $40 (stated regular price) but is a good value at $22.79.
